Key Insights
The European image sensor market, valued at approximately €10 billion in 2025, is projected to experience robust growth, driven by a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 8.60% from 2025 to 2033. This expansion is fueled by several key factors. The burgeoning consumer electronics sector, particularly smartphones and advanced cameras, constitutes a significant driver. Furthermore, the increasing adoption of image sensors in automotive applications, including advanced driver-assistance systems (ADAS) and autonomous vehicles, significantly contributes to market growth. The healthcare sector also presents a promising avenue, with the rising demand for medical imaging technologies like endoscopy and microscopy bolstering market demand. Technological advancements, such as the development of higher-resolution sensors with improved sensitivity and lower power consumption, further accelerate market expansion. Germany, France, and the United Kingdom represent the largest national markets within Europe, reflecting their strong technological base and established manufacturing sectors. The competitive landscape is characterized by a mix of established players like Sony, Samsung, and STMicroelectronics, alongside specialized companies catering to niche applications.
However, market growth is not without challenges. The high initial investment costs associated with advanced image sensor technology can pose a barrier to entry for smaller companies. Supply chain disruptions and fluctuations in raw material prices also present potential headwinds. Furthermore, intense competition among manufacturers necessitates continuous innovation and cost optimization to maintain market share. Despite these restraints, the long-term outlook for the European image sensor market remains positive, driven by ongoing technological advancements and increasing demand across diverse end-user industries. Key Markets & Segments Leading Europe Image Sensors Industry
The Europe image sensor market shows significant segmentation across various types, end-user industries, and geographic regions.
By Type:
- CMOS: CMOS sensors dominate the market due to their cost-effectiveness, lower power consumption, and ease of integration. This segment is forecast to continue its dominance throughout the forecast period.
- CCD: The CCD segment holds a smaller market share but remains relevant in niche applications requiring high-quality image capture.
By End-User Industry:
- Consumer Electronics: This segment represents the largest portion of the market, driven by the widespread adoption of smartphones, tablets, and digital cameras. Strong economic growth and increasing disposable incomes in key European countries are propelling growth.
- Automotive and Transportation: The automotive industry is a key growth driver, fueled by the increasing adoption of Advanced Driver-Assistance Systems (ADAS) and autonomous driving technologies. Government regulations promoting vehicle safety are further stimulating demand.
- Healthcare: The healthcare sector presents significant opportunities for image sensors in medical imaging applications, such as endoscopy and microscopy. Technological advancements and increasing healthcare expenditure are key drivers.
- Security and Surveillance: The security and surveillance industry is experiencing steady growth, driven by the rising need for enhanced security measures in various sectors. Government initiatives promoting public safety and technological advancements are stimulating this market. Other end-user industries, such as industrial automation, aerospace, and defense also contribute to market growth, but their contributions are currently comparatively less significant than the segments mentioned above.
By Country:
- Germany: Germany, with its strong automotive and industrial sectors, is a leading market for image sensors in Europe. A robust technological ecosystem and a supportive regulatory environment contribute to its dominance.
- United Kingdom: The UK benefits from a well-established electronics industry and research infrastructure, positioning it as a significant market for image sensors.
- France: France plays a noteworthy role in the market, particularly in sectors such as aerospace and defense, with significant investments in technological advancements.
- Italy: Italy’s contributions to the image sensor market are relatively moderate compared to Germany or the UK but have demonstrated consistent growth.
- Rest of Europe: This segment encompasses several countries exhibiting growth potential in specific applications.
Europe Image Sensors Industry Product Developments
Recent years have witnessed significant advancements in image sensor technology, leading to the development of smaller, higher-resolution sensors with improved low-light performance and enhanced functionalities. The introduction of 50-million-pixel and even 200-million-pixel sensors by companies such as Samsung and SK Hynix showcases the continuous drive towards higher resolution imaging. Simultaneously, the development of innovative technologies like single-photon avalanche diodes (SPADs) is expanding the capabilities of image sensors for specialized applications, such as low-light photography. These technological advancements are creating competitive edges for manufacturers and opening up new market opportunities in various sectors.

8. Can you provide examples of recent developments in the market?
January 2022 - SK Hynix started to mass-produce 0.7 image sensors, getting into competition with Sony and Samsung Electronics in the global image sensor market. The company recently began volume production of 0.7 50-million-pixel image sensors, which are at the same level as Sony products. Samsung Electronics launched a 0.64 50-million-pixel image sensor, one of the industry's smallest, in June 2021 and introduced a 0.64 200-million-pixel sensor in September 2021. Recently, Omnivision of China also took the wraps off a 0.62-pixel image sensor at CES 2022.
